Family-Friendly 5-Day Jaipur to Amarnath Itinerary in July 2023

  1. Day 1: Jaipur
    Starting Point
    Destination: Hawa Mahal
    Estimated Time: 20 minutes (5.8 km)

    Start your day by visiting the iconic Hawa Mahal, also known as the Palace of Winds. Marvel at its unique architecture and intricate designs. In the afternoon, head over to the City Palace, a complex of palaces, gardens, and courtyards that showcases the rich history of the city. End your day by exploring the bustling markets in the old city, where you can find handmade crafts, textiles, and jewelry.

  2. Day 2: Jaipur to Jodhpur
    Starting Point: Jaipur
    Destination: Mehrangarh Fort
    Estimated Time: 5 hours (337 km)

    Start early and head to Jodhpur, also known as the Blue City. Once you arrive, visit the Mehrangarh Fort, a UNESCO World Heritage Site that dates back to the 15th century. Spend the afternoon exploring the bustling markets and trying out local delicacies. In the evening, enjoy a cultural show at the Jaswant Thada, a white marble monument built in memory of Maharaja Jaswant Singh II.

  3. Day 3: Jodhpur to Udaipur
    Starting Point: Jodhpur
    Destination: Lake Pichola
    Estimated Time: 4 hours (250 km)

    Head to Udaipur, also known as the City of Lakes. Start your day by taking a boat ride on Lake Pichola, one of the most scenic spots in the city. Visit the City Palace, a stunning complex of palaces, courtyards, and gardens that overlooks the lake. In the evening, catch a cultural show at the Bagore Ki Haveli, a heritage museum that showcases the art and culture of Rajasthan.

Recommendations

If you have extra time, consider visiting the Pushkar Lake, one of the most sacred lakes in India. You can also take a side trip to the nearby city of Ajmer, which is home to the famous Ajmer Sharif Dargah. To maximize your fun, make sure to try out the local cuisine, which includes dal bati churma, gatte ki sabzi, and laal maas. Finally, don't forget to haggle at the local markets to get the best deals on souvenirs and handicrafts.
